WORLDS INC. ANNOUNCES INTERNET AGREEMENT
WITH POLYGRAM MERCHANDISING, INC.

Plans To Create Online 'SuperStars SuperStore'

Worlds to have Debut Press Conference for
First 3D Internet 'SuperStars SuperStore.com'
on Tuesday, November 24th

New York, NY – October 12th, 1998 – Worlds Inc. ("Worlds"), a pioneer in the development of 3D Internet technology, and PolyGram Merchandising Inc. ("PolyGram Merchandising"), one of this country's leading licensees of recording artist merchandise, including collectibles, announced the signing of an agreement that will permit Worlds to develop, maintain and operate a 2D, or traditional HTML, as well as a 3D Internet website, through which Worlds will promote and sell the merchandise of PolyGram Merchandising's licensed artists, utilizing Worlds' proprietary Internet technology and content. Worlds 3DCD™ Internet software and content permits animation and motion on the Internet, including a user's ability to experience moving into and out of various spaces via the selection of an avatar (one's alter ego character) for self-representation on the Internet.

Among the recording artists and others whose products are licensed by PolyGram Merchandising and whose products will be sold by Worlds in the online 'SuperStars SuperStore.com' are (in alphabetical order) All Saints, David Bowie, Billy Ray Cyrus, Hanson, Elton John, John Mellencamp, Shania Twain, The Spice Girls, Sting, U2, and Warren G, among others.

Thom Kidrin, President and CEO of Worlds, said "this Agreement with PolyGram Merchandising further reinforces Worlds' growing recognition in the area of 3D Internet technology and content as this relates to the music, and now, music merchandise industry." Tom Bennett, President and CEO of PolyGram Merchandising, noted that "this relationship with Worlds affords PolyGram Merchandising with an opportunity to allow consumers worldwide to purchase PolyGram Merchandising licensed artist merchandise over the Internet, one of the fastest growing major commerce environments of the twentieth century."

A Press Conference debuting the launch of Worlds' 'SuperStars SuperStores.com' is planned for Tuesday, November 24th. After the launch, Internet users may access Worlds' traditional 2D or HTML Internet 'SuperStars SuperStore' by the URL 'www.WorldsStore.com' or 'www.SuperStarsSuperStore.com.' Worlds 3D Internet 'SuperStars SuperStore' can be accessed by using Worlds 3DCD™ which are scheduled for press distribution at the Press Conference and mass distribution in December.

About Worlds Inc. 3D Internet Technology and Content
Worlds 3DCD™ Internet software and content embedded on traditional audio CDs, as an enhanced, value added feature, permits animation and motion on the Internet. Worlds 3DCD™ software and content permit online users to experience moving into and out of various spaces via the selection of an avatar (one's alter ego character) for self-representation on the Internet. Worlds Avatar Gallery has over 100 different characters (avatars) from which an online user may select his or her online character, be it a real person, an animal, a cartoon character, or even a bird. These online users can also meet other avatars with whom they can communicate in various ways, including, but not limited to traditional text chat or real voice-to-voice chat; these users can even wave to and dance with one another and exhibit numerous other behavior patterns, all in a highly interactive, real time, online environment.
